Marketing strategies for live bingo: How to attract and retain new players

Marketing is a vital aspect of any business, and the world of live bingo is no exception. The online bingo industry is rapidly expanding, and it is becoming increasingly competitive.

With so many options available to players, it is essential for bingo operators to have an effective marketing strategy in place. A well-planned and executed marketing strategy can attract new players and keep existing ones engaged, ultimately leading to increased revenue.

In this article, we will delve into some of the most effective marketing techniques that online live bingo operators can use to achieve their goals. By implementing the following strategies, platforms can connect with potential players and foster a loyal player base, driving success for their business.

What is the difference between online bingo and traditional bingo?

One convenient aspect of online live bingo is that it can be played from home whilst retaining several of the enjoyable aspects found in games hosted at traditional bingo halls. Of course, one main difference is that, instead of using physical bingo cards and daubers, online players use virtual cards and can mark off numbers with a click. The social aspect of the game, however, is preserved through chat features, allowing players to interact with each other and the live host in real-time.

Social Media Marketing

Utilising social media platforms like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and Snapchat can be a potent strategy for marketing live bingo games. These platforms can be leveraged to connect with potential players and promote bingo events. They can create appealing content that entices their followers to share their posts, effectively expanding their reach. Additionally, operators can partner with influencers who have a large following and who align with their brand values.

Email Marketing

Email marketing is another effective way of promoting live bingo games. Online bingo game platforms can create email lists of players who have opted in to receive their promotional messages. They can then send regular emails highlighting upcoming games, special promotions, and bonuses. These emails can also contain information about new game releases and other relevant news.

Loyalty Programs

Implementing loyalty programs is an effective strategy for retaining existing players in bingo games. By providing bonuses, free games, and other incentives, loyal players can be rewarded. In addition, loyalty tiers can be created where players can earn more benefits as they progress up the ladder. By offering appealing rewards, the possibility of encouraging players to continue using the service is increased.

Referral Programs

Referral programs can also be used to draw in new players. Bingo operators can offer incentives to existing players who refer their friends and family to the site. These incentives can include bonuses, free games, or even cash rewards. This approach allows bingo sites to tap into the power of word-of-mouth marketing, which is one of the most effective marketing techniques.

The success of an online live bingo business relies heavily on an effective marketing strategy. As the online bingo industry continues to evolve, with new competitors emerging, it is crucial for operators to stay up-to-date with the latest marketing trends and techniques. By continuously evolving their marketing strategy, they can remain relevant and attract new players while keeping existing ones engaged.
